Mapping Active Directory Syntax to ADSI Syntax
The following table maps the Active Directory syntaxes to their corresponding ADSI syntaxes.
| Attribute syntax ID | Active Directory syntax type | Equivalent ADSI syntax type |
|---|---|---|
| 2.5.5.1 |
DN String |
DN String |
| 2.5.5.2 |
Object ID |
CaseIgnore String |
| 2.5.5.3 |
Case Sensitive String |
CaseExact String |
| 2.5.5.4 |
Case Ignored String |
CaseIgnore String |
| 2.5.5.5 |
Print Case String |
Printable String |
| 2.5.5.6 |
Numeric String |
Numeric String |
| 2.5.5.7 |
OR Name DNWithOctetString |
Not Supported |
| 2.5.5.8 |
Boolean |
Boolean |
| 2.5.5.9 |
Integer |
Integer |
| 2.5.5.10 |
Octet String |
Octet String |
| 2.5.5.11 |
Time |
UTC Time |
| 2.5.5.12 |
Unicode |
Case Ignore String |
| 2.5.5.13 |
Address |
Not Supported |
| 2.5.5.14 |
Distname-Address |
|
| 2.5.5.15 |
NT Security Descriptor |
IADsSecurityDescriptor |
| 2.5.5.16 |
Large Integer |
IADsLargeInteger |
| 2.5.5.17 |
SID |
Octet String |